github移动app开发框架
GitHub是目前全球最大的开源代码托管平台,提供了丰富的功能和工具,方便开发者共享和管理代码。而移动App开发框架则是一种提供了一系列开发工具和组件的软件框架,帮助开发者创建和构建移动应用程序。本文将重点介绍GitHub移动App开发框架的原理和详细信息。一、原理介绍GitHub...
2024-09-23 围观 : 0次
随着移动互联网的发展,APP 已然成为人们在手机上使用的主要方式之一。随之而来的就是APP 开发人员的迫切需求。本文将为您介绍APP 开发的原理和详细的开发流程。
1. 开发语言
APP 开发需要掌握程序语言,同时掌握多种语言将更有优势。常见的语言有 Objective-C、Swift、Java、C#等。
2. 设计模式
开发一个 APP 需要考虑到用户体验,需要遵循一定的设计模式,常见的设计模式有 MVC、MVP、MVVM等。
3. 架构设计
APP 开发是一个复杂的过程,需要清晰的架构设计才能保证代码结构的清晰、代码的可读性和维护便利性。常见的架构有三层架构、单例模式等。
4. UI设计
好的UI设计能够让用户对产品产生好感,从而提高用户留存率。在UI设计中需要注意色彩、图标、文字布局等。
5. 数据库设计
APP 开发需要存储大量的数据,需要清晰的数据库设计,常见的数据库有 MySql、Oracle、SqlServer等。
6. 安全
APP 的安全性也是开发中不可忽视的方面,常见的安全问题有数据加密、用户身份认证、网络防护等。
7. 适配
不同设备的屏幕大小、分辨率、操作系统等都不尽相同,这就需要开发人员在 APP 开发中需要适配不同的设备。
8. 测试和发布
APP 开发过程中需要进行严格的测试,确保产品的高质量。测试主要包括自动化测试和手动测试。测试完成后才能发布。
以上内容是 APP 开发中需要关注的方方面面,下面我们详细介绍下 APP 开发的流程。
1. 需求分析
APP 开发的第一步是分析需求,确定产品功能点和架构设计。
2. UI设计
在需求分析完成后即可开始UI设计的工作,通过美观的设计来提高用户体验。
3. 程序编写
在 UI 设计完成后,需要编程人员实现程序的代码编写,将 UI 设计呈现在程序上。
4. 测试
代码编写完成后,需要进行全面测试,包括功能测试、性能测试和兼容性测试等。
5. 发布
在测试通过后即可提交到 App Store 后,等待审核批准通过后即可正式发布产品。
6. 迭代更新
进行了发布后,需要不断关注用户反馈,进行迭代更新,不断提升产品质量。
以上就是 APP 开发的流程和注意事项,希望对你有所帮助。
GitHub是目前全球最大的开源代码托管平台,提供了丰富的功能和工具,方便开发者共享和管理代码。而移动App开发框架则是一种提供了一系列开发工具和组件的软件框架,帮助开发者创建和构建移动应用程序。本文将重点介绍GitHub移动App开发框架的原理和详细信息。一、原理介绍GitHub...
URL Schema是一种用于移动应用程序的协议,它允许应用程序通过链接来打开其他应用程序或执行特定的任务。在移动应用程序开发中,URL Schema是一种非常有用的技术,可以帮助应用程序之间进行无缝集成。以下是URL Schema的详细介绍。URL Schema是一种自定义协议,其格式类似于标准的...
制作一个自己的App,已经成为了很多人想要尝试的事情之一,但是因为技能和资源的限制,很多人不敢尝试。其实在电脑上自己制作App并不是一件困难的事情。在制作App的过程中需要学习的技能也不多,本文将从制作原理的角度向大家简单介绍如何用电脑自己制作App。1. 选择一个开发平台在制作 app 的过程中,...
HTML5是现代化的语言,能够为开发人员提供更好的访问设备的能力,尤其是移动设备。HTML5为移动设备带来了许多好处,它可以使开发人员轻松地创建出全功能的移动应用程序。一、什么是HTML5HTML5是一种网络开发语言,用于开发Web和移动应用程序。HTML5由一种跨平台的标准、Web和应用程序API...
近年来,随着各种社交电商盛行,返利App也越来越受欢迎。然而,很多想要自己制作返利App的人却因为不懂技术而望而却步。其实,只要您有一定的学习能力和耐心,完全可以利用现有的技术自己动手制作一个返利App。首先,我们需要了解返利App的原理。返利App的核心功能就是通过用户在App上进行购物消费来获得...